Local and International Expertise
Southwark's tour operators offer an impressive range of experiences. Some specialise in London-focused tours, showcasing the borough's rich heritage around Bankside, Borough Market and the historic riverside, as well as the wider capital's museums, architecture and food scene. Others design international itineraries spanning Europe, Asia, Africa and beyond. This dual focus means the borough's operators are equally adept at introducing visitors to the treasures on their doorstep and at guiding travellers through complex overseas journeys with confidence and care.

Responsible and Sustainable Tourism
Increasingly, Southwark's tour operators are embracing responsible tourism practices. This includes supporting locally owned businesses, limiting group sizes to reduce impact, respecting cultural sites and choosing lower-impact transport where possible. Many operators now design itineraries that benefit host communities directly, ensuring that tourism contributes positively to the places visited. For conscientious travellers, choosing an operator with strong ethical and environmental credentials adds meaning to the journey and reflects a wider shift toward more thoughtful travel.
How to Choose the Right Operator
Selecting a tour operator depends on the kind of experience you seek. Consider whether you prefer small-group intimacy or larger organised tours, and whether a general or specialist focus suits your interests. Reviewing an operator's itineraries reveals their style and priorities, while their reputation and the quality of their guides offer clues to the experience you can expect. Clear communication, transparent inclusions and flexibility are all positive indicators. Taking time to ask questions before booking helps ensure the tour aligns with your expectations and travel goals.
